This group recommended, for National Monument status, approximately the area included within the present boundaries. This recommendation was approved by the Secretary of the Interior on December 28, 1935, and the Presidential proclamation creating Organ Pipe Cactus National Monument was signed on April 13, 1937. Sep 2, 2023 · Organ Pipe Cactus National Monument occupies a small part of the massive area called the Basin and Range Province. This region stretches from its eastern boundary in West Texas to its western boundary at the foothills of the Sierra Nevada range in California. In what is now Organ Pipe Cactus National Monument, archaeological evidence places human beings in this area approximately 16,000 years ago. These people left behind projectile points, seashells, pottery, and rock art. The paths they followed on foot are still carved onto the desert floor.Join Us at Organ Pipe Cactus National Monument! Find park updates, applications, …Beginning in the 1890s, the Victoria Mine was the center of this sporadic mining of gold and silver in the Organ Pipe Cactus National Monument region. While the most extensive efforts occurred between the 1890s and the 1910s, periodic mining efforts took place through 1976, operating under a special use permit from the National Park Service. Currently nine zones are open for backcountry camping. Permits are required and available at the Kris Eggle Visitor Center. Group size and zone capacity are limited. Backcountry camping is $5.00 per zone (per group or individual) and is good for 7 nights. The Organ Pipe Cactus (Stenocereus thurberi) Organ Pipe Cactus National Monument is the only place in the United States to see large stands of organ pipe cacti growing naturally, though their range extends far south into Mexico. The organ pipe cactus is a wonderful example of the adaptations that cacti need to flourish in the Sonoran Desert. Aug 19, 2023 · Reptiles. The chuckwalla is a common lizard in the monument. During the heat of the day, many snakes and lizards, like this chuckwalla, will take shelter under rocks or in small caves. Naturally, a variety of reptiles make their home in the arid desert. Because reptiles can not regulate their body temperature, they are considered cold-blooded ...
